Seventeen-year-old Kayla Jackson has one goal: graduate and move on. But just weeks before her big day, life spins off course when a tragic accident leaves her twin brother critically injured-and her mother gone.

Torn between grief and responsibility, Kayla is forced to live with her father's new family, navigate her final days of high school, and somehow deliver a graduation speech that now means more than ever.

Amid the chaos, a forgotten classmate resurfaces-Darren, the quiet boy from Forensics class-offering support, honesty, and something Kayla didn't know she needed: hope. As she juggles grief, family tensions, love, and the weight of growing up too soon, Kayla must decide what kind of future she wants-and how much of her past she's ready to carry forward.

Beneath the Surface is a raw, heartfelt coming-of-age story about loss, love, and the quiet power of showing up-even when life doesn't go as planned.
